What is British Pound (GBP)

The British Pound, symbolized as £, is the official currency of the United Kingdom and its territories. It is one of the oldest existing currencies still in use today, with roots dating back to the 8th century. The Pound is subdivided into 100 smaller units called pence (singular: penny). The GBP is widely recognized as one of the strongest and most stable currencies in the world, often serving as a benchmark for other currencies.

The British Pound is issued by the Bank of England, which regulates its supply and implements monetary policy. Due to the UK's significant role in global finance, the Pound often sees high trading volumes on the foreign exchange markets. As an international currency, it is often used in trade and investment around the world, making it crucial for those engaged in global business, travel, or financial services.

What is Uzbekistani Som (UZS)

The Uzbekistani Som, abbreviated as UZS, is the official currency of Uzbekistan. Introduced in 1994, it replaced the Soviet Ruble at a fixed exchange rate. The Som is subdivided into 100 tiyin, although tiyin are not frequently used in everyday transactions. The symbol for the Som is “сум”.

Uzbekistan has undergone significant economic reforms since its independence in 1991, transitioning from a centrally planned economy to a more market-oriented one. The central bank of Uzbekistan, the Central Bank of the Republic of Uzbekistan, issues the Som and is responsible for managing the country’s monetary policy.
